Here's how townships are acting on Franklin County data center law

Summary by The Keystone
Several townships in Franklin County that lack zoning are looking into or moving ahead with proposed ordinances to regulate data centers. The developments come as the county commissioners this week adopted an amendment to the county’s subdivision and land development ordinances, collectively known as SALDO, meant to help municipalities set rules for companies that may seek to develop data centers in the area.
